Technical Problem

In existing technologies, configuring the accompanying motion effects of virtual monster hit animations requires a lot of manual processing, resulting in low production efficiency.

Method used

By setting the motion transmission relationship between parts of a virtual object, the system automatically generates associated motion effects, reducing manual configuration steps and using interactive operations to trigger vibration or rotational movements in multiple parts.

Benefits of technology

It improves the configuration efficiency of interactive feedback and the efficiency of human-computer interaction, and clearly reflects the differences between different interactive operations.

Abstract

This application discloses an interactive motion feedback method, apparatus, device, medium, and program product, relating to the field of computer technology. The method includes: displaying a virtual object in a virtual scene; receiving a first interactive operation acting on a first object part of at least two object parts; responding to the first interactive operation, displaying a first vibration action performed by the first object part of the virtual object; and displaying a second vibration action performed by a second object part through motion transmission from the first vibration action. By setting the motion transmission relationship, the associated motion effect (i.e., the second vibration action) generated by the first vibration action on the second object part can be automatically generated, eliminating the need for manual configuration of the associated motion effect and improving the configuration efficiency of interactive feedback.
